A comparative study of fuzzy controlled genetic algorithms for reconfiguration of radial distribution systems
A lot of energy can be saved by efficient reconfiguration of radial distribution systems (RDS) under network constraints. In this paper, a novel genetic algorithm based approach has been adopted for network reconfiguration. The attractive features of the proposed approach are: an improved chromosome coding and an efficient convergence characteristics attributed to fuzzy controlled mutation. A systematic and comparative study of different genetic algorithms and simulation results has been presented and discussed. |
